We compared two Integrated graphics card GPUs: 0System Shared VRAM Radeon RX Vega 11 Embedded and 0System Shared VRAM Radeon HD 8240 Mobile IGP to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on RX Vega 11 Embedded 's Advantages
Released 4 years and 5 months late
Boost Clock1251MHz
576 additional rendering cores
AMD Radeon HD 8240 Mobile IGP 's Advantages
Lower TDP (15W vs 35W)
